II Issue 8D HOLABIRD YOUTHS TESTED FOR WEST NILE VIRUS It may have been just a tad premature to claim that Holabird is not being effected by the dreaded West Nile Virus. Two of Holabird's young people are suspected of having the virus and are awaiting test results. If either of the children or anyone else test positive for this we will let you, the Reader, know. WHO ISN'T RUNNING FOR CALIFORNIA GOVERNOR by Jerry Hinkle, Special to the Holabird Advocate Politics used to be a spectator sport in the Peoples Republic of California. Lately it seems that everyone and his dog is running for the Governor's office. Arnold Schartzenegger is running, so is Gary Coleman. There are also strippers, porn actresses, hippies, and even a few crazies thrown in for good measure to join the fray. Looks like I'm the only one not running. Am I missing something here? Why are all these people running? There are so many candidates that they are signing each other petitions. I wonder if these people realize the full scope that the job of Governor of California represents. From what I hear, none of the candidates could possibly be worse than the guy already in the Governor's chair, but then I could be wrong about that.
